Baby Duck Card

- Required supplies:
- White cardstock and Aqua and yellow cardstock with a white core (from Die Cuts with a View)
- Fiskars ScrapBoss Embossing System
- Fiskars 12” x 12” Themed Baby Stencil Set
- Yellow and aqua chalk
- Yellow gingham ribbon and yellow safety pins
- White terry cloth, foam tape, sandpaper, and tape runner
- Fiskars Bubbles Texture Plate Energy
Instructions

- Create a 5” square card from white cardstock.
- Chalk edges with yellow.
- Use the Texturing Tool and Bubbles Texture Plate and emboss a 4 ½” square piece of aqua cardstock. Lightly sand to reveal images and adhere to front of card.
- Emboss several ½” strips of aqua with bubbles, sand, chalk edges and adhere on foam tape across the upper right corner.
- Use the ScrapBoss Embossing System and the Themed Baby Stencil Set and emboss the duck on yellow cardstock.
- Cut out duck about 1/8” away from embossing and lightly sand to reveal image.
- Emboss a separate wing and bill from yellow, cut out and sand. Mount on foam tape on duck for added dimension.
- Adhere duck to front of card.
- Place a piece of terry cloth across bottom of card.
- Emboss sentiment using the CardBoss Baby Stencil Set onto a piece of aqua cardstock and sand. Place on center of cloth piece.
- Knot pieces of ribbon and place at sides of word strip.
- Place a safety pin through each ribbon.
